Ingredients
Gather these ingredients to make your cookies:
For the Cookies
- 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 3/4 cup brown s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 large egg
- 1/2 cup chopped apples
- 1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ans (optional)
For the Filling
- 1 cup apple pie filling
- 1/2 cup salted caramel sauce
For Topping
- Extra salted caramel sauce
- Sea salt for sprinkling
Make sure to measure everything accurately for the best results!
Instructions
Follow these steps to create your delicious cookies:
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Mix Dry Ingredients
In a b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
Cream Butter and Sugars
In a larger bowl, cream the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
Add Egg and Vanilla
Beat in the egg and vanilla extract until combined.
Combine Mixtures
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ture and mix until just combined.
Fold in Apples
Gently fold in the chopped apples and nuts if using.
Scoop and Bake
Scoop tablespoon-sized amounts of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, creating a well in the center to add apple pie filling.
Add Filling
Fill each well with apple pie filling and bake for about 15-20 minutes or until golden.
Drizzle with Caramel
Allow to cool slightly before drizzling with salted caramel sauce and sprinkling with sea salt.
Your cookies are now ready to be enjoyed!
Tips for Perfect Cookies
For perfectly soft and chewy cookies, be sure not to overmix the dough once you add the dry ingredients. Mixing just until combined helps retain that tender texture. Also, consider using room temperature butter for easier creaming with sugars, resulting in a lighter cookie.
Another tip is to chill the cookie dough for about 30 minutes before baking. This can help the cookies maintain their shape and texture during baking, leading to an even more delightful end product.
Storage and Freshness
To keep your Salted Caramel Apple Pie C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to five days. If you want to enjoy them longer, consider freezing them. Once baked, allow cookies to cool completely before placing them in a single layer in a freezer-safe container, with parchment paper between layers to prevent sticking.
When you're ready to enjoy them, simply thaw at room temperature or warm them up in the oven for a few minutes. This will bring back that freshly baked aroma and taste, reminding you of the joy of baking.
Questions About Recipes
→ Can I make these cookies in advance?
Yes! You can prepare the dough ahead of time and refrigerate it until you're ready to bake.
→ What if I don’t have apple pie filling?
You can make your own by cooking diced apples with cinnamon and sugar until soft.
